TI中文支持网
TI专业的中文技术问题搜集分享网站

MCBSP发送中断的触发过程是什么?

①   TMS320F28335中的MCBSP发送中断,用XRDY信号触发发送中断,刚上电启动DSP时,程序运行到主函数中的while(1)等待循环里,MCBSP发送中断外面没有MCBSP发送的代码,发送代码都在MCBSP中断里面,这时,系统是怎么触发MCBSP发送中断并进入中断里面的呢?

②  MCBSP发送中断里面的数据发送完最后一个数据时,XRDY信号由0变为1,再次触发中断,这次再进入中断后里面已无要发送的数据,此时XRDY一直保持置位1,程序是一直在这个中断里呢还是会跳出来?如果跳出来的话,之后怎么才能再次从中断外部进入中断呢?

Joey Mao:

XRDY在进入中断和中断结束的过程中是会被置1和清零的,具体的过程描述,你可以看MCBSP的数据手册2.6 McBSP Transmission的时序图以及下面的5点具体的描述

赞(0)
未经允许不得转载:TI中文支持网 » MCBSP发送中断的触发过程是什么?
分享到: 更多 (0)